连接边缘baetyl-broker 背景描述 BIE内置baetyl-broker应用,作为边缘消息中间件。同时BIE内置南向驱动采集的数据,也都是先到baetyl-broker模块,然后通过云边协同baetyl-core将消息上报至云端。为了调试方便,通常有连接边缘baetyl-broker查看指定topic消息的需求。
远程SSH边缘节点 概述 本文介绍进程模式节点远程调试功能,用户可以通过BIE云端管理平台远程SSH链接边缘节点。该功能同时支持Windows和Linux操作系统。 使用该功能前,请确保边缘节点安装了openssh Server。 操作指南 创建进程模式节点 首先创建一个进程模式的节点,创建方式参考“节点管理->进程模式节点“章节。
点击右边的 详情按钮 ,查看部署详情,如下图所示: 节点:test 端口:8093 部署记录ID: mdp-ppv2gp2hvg07bzjb 打开智能边缘界面,找到test节点,查看mdp-ppv2gp2hvg07bzjb应用的部署状态,如下图所示: 可以看到,在智能边缘界面,确实创建了mdp-ppv2gp2hvg07bzjb应用,并部署到了test节点上,并且状态已经是 已部署 。
点击右边的 详情按钮 ,查看部署详情,如下图所示: 节点:test 端口:8094 部署记录ID: mdp-4fn7k2tve4xyknp1 打开智能边缘界面,找到test节点,查看 mdp-4fn7k2tve4xyknp1 应用的部署状态,如下图所示: 可以看到,在智能边缘界面,确实创建了mdp-4fn7k2tve4xyknp1应用,并部署到了test节点上,并且状态已经是 已部署 。
expiration string 非必须 sts过期时间 用户在获取到该返回值后,即可在边缘端进行对象存储的访问,其具有以下路径的访问权限: http:// { endpoint } / { bucket } / { namespace } / { nodeName } 注意:用户需要自行判断sts的过期时间,在过期后,重新通过边缘openapi更新sts。
使用函数调用边缘AI模型 1、场景 边缘节点上部署了AI模型,现在希望使用函数触发式调用AI模型,并将AI模型返回结果发送到边缘Broker当中,供其他用户应用订阅。
用户可以基于现有单元,进行灵活的编排组合,生成多样技能,满足不同的边缘业务需求。 技能编辑完成后可以生成对应的业务模版,用户可以将业务模版部署至节点,生成多个应用。 单元串联 单元可以通过拖拉拽的方式组合成一个技能。画布右侧支持修改单元特定的属性。 符合什么条件的单元可以串联 : 目前单元因为针对场景设计,有些单元需要按照指定的个数数据进行输入输出。
点击【部署到端设备】.选中在智能边缘创建的边缘节点,端口号输入8701.点击部署后,该模型将自动以应用的形式部署到端设备上。 进入「智能边缘」控制台,选中对应的节点,可以看到应用已经出现在应用列表。当节点连上云端时,会自动将该应用部署到节点上。 验证 边缘侧应用部署成功后,调用部署到边缘侧的AI服务来验证这个demo。在浏览器输入:<边缘ip>:8701。
四、边缘应用描述 除了边缘节点连接云端是自动部署的系统应用,还需要在边缘节点上部署以下三个应用 序号 应用名 用途 1 vi-function 模型推断结果后处理函数,将模型推断结果解析成可识别数据 2 video-infer 模型推断应用,负责加载AI模型并执行AI推断 3 remote-object 将边缘推断图片上传到云端对象存储 最终边缘节点上将会有6个边缘应用,如下图所示 五、边缘应用关系
云边协同 云端AI中台训练的模型可以通过BIE下发部署到边缘节点,同时通过边缘节点的数据采集应用与数据远传应用,可以将样本数据实时采集并上传至云端,为AI中台提供训练样本素材,云端可以将优化后的模型再下发部署至边缘节点,从而实现整体闭环。 安全可靠 边云通讯安全:云管套件为每一个边缘节点颁发唯一的节点证书,边缘节点与云管套件建立基于证书的双向通道,实现数据交互的认证与加密。